monty loves his fruits and veggies but only raw:unsure: am i right in thinking that he can all veggies raw apart from potatoes, i have bought a small turnip ans parsnip so just thought id check before trying him with them. thanks in advance

Posted

As far as I know any fruits and vegetables except for the potatoes are fine for eating raw so let Monty eat away at those fresh goodies. If I am wrong Tracy will correct me as she is the mod of the bird food room and she will know if any others are to be excluded from the raw list.

Posted

Di both the parsnip & turnip can be eaten raw,be sure to wash and peel the skin.I tend to boil or steam them for 5 minutes.The tops of them are packed with vitamins & minerals,sometimes they are sold separately in the supermarket.
